Salman Khan seems to have decided to opt out of the sequel to his 2005 slapstick comedy ‘No Entry’. Initially, Sallu had agreed to feature in a double role in the sequel, to be produced by Boney Kapoor. But reports now suggest that he has taken a step back, with Hrithik Roshan being considered for the role. Apparently, Salman has a busy calendar in the coming year. ‘Tubelight’, Tiger Zinda Hai’, ‘Ode To My Father’, ‘Dabangg 3’, ‘Kick 2’ and ‘Wanted 2’ are some of the films he will be doing in the near future. This leaves him less time to spare for any other project and hence seems to have denied the sequel to ‘No Entry’.
